Description

Senior Indonesian Army officers currently visiting Australia, this week gained first-hand knowledge of how the Australian Army operates in the field. The twenty officers from all arms of the Indonesian Army visited the Sydney-based 5th Battalion, The Royal Australian Regiment which is currently taking part in exercise Temple Tower in North Queensland. The officers accompanied by the GOC Field Force Command, Major General K. Mackay and his Chief of Staff, Brigadier J. Hooton were briefed by the exercise director, Brigadier J. J. Shelton (Commander of 3 Task Force) before moving to the exercise area by RAAF Iroquois helicopters. At the Battalion HQ they were met by the CO of 5 RAR Lieutenant Colonel K. Newman and shown the BHQ area and defensive positions. During their visit the BHQ came under a mock artillery attack which stirred the CP and mortar platoon into action. The Infantry officers with the party stayed overnight with the Battalion. The Exercise Temple Tower is a two phase exercise involving the Australian Army, with RAN and RAAF support, a company of Papua New Guinea soldiers (which took part in phase one) and a composite New Zealand Infantry Company. The overall aim is to practise the skills required of an Infantry Battalion and to practise joint service procedures. The exercise was an ideal opportunity for the Indonesian officers to observe Australian operations in the field. Also identified: Major Green, Supply Company, 5th Battalion; Lance Corporal Allan Sheather of Moss Vale, NSW; Colonel Kusnadi; Major Rollo Brett; Colonel Kidrosin.
